How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 91740?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 91740 Studio Apartments | $1,751 | $1,575 | $2,325 |
| 91740 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,266 | $1,950 | $2,890 |
| 91740 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,768 | $1,645 | $3,500 |
| 91740 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,856 | $3,715 | $4,260 |
